The mother of murdered gunman Tristan Sherry, aged 26, was unable to recognise her son because his face was so badly beaten when a group set upon him after he fatally shot gangland figure Jason Hennessy Snr in a busy restaurant on Christmas Eve over two years ago, the Special Criminal Court has heard.
Fiona Murphy, prosecuting, at a sentencing hearing for three men convicted of Sherry's murder, on Thursday read statements by the deceased's mother, Mary Hand and sister, Savannah.
